 Jewish Study Bible by Oxford University Press, oxford University Press breaks exciting new ground in the field of study Bibles with The Jewish Study Bible. This innovative volume will, for the first time, offer readers of the Hebrew Bible a resource that is specifically tailored to meet their needs. The JSB presents the center of gravity of the Scriptures where Jews experience it--in Torah. It offers readers the fruits of various schools of Jewish traditions of biblical exegesis (rabbinic, medieval, mystical, etc.) and provides them with a wealth of ancillary materials that aid in bringing the ancient text to life. The nearly forty contributors to the work represent the cream of Jewish biblical scholarship from the world over. The JSB uses The Jewish Publication Society TANAKH Translation, whose name is an acronym formed from the Hebrew initials of the three sections into which the Hebrew Bible is traditionally divided (Torah, Instruction; Nevi'im, prophets; and Kethubim, Writings). A committee of esteemed biblical scholars and rabbis from the Orthodox, Conservative, and Reform Judaism movements produced this modern translation, which dates from 1985. Unlike other English translations based upon such ancient versions as the Septuagint and Vulgate, which emend the Hebrew text, TANAKH is faithful to the original text.  Brandeis Modern Hebrew with CDROM Written by the core faculty of the Hebrew Program at Brandeis University, Brandies Modern is an accessible introduction to the Hebrew language for American undergraduates and high school students. Its functional and contexual elements are designed to bring students from the beginner level to the intermediate level, and to familiarize them with those linguistic aspects that will prepare them to function in advanced stages. This volume reflects some of the main principle that have shaped the Brandies Hebrew curriculum during the past decade. The text in this edition comprises a short introduction to the instructor, 11 units, supplementary Hebrew profieciency guidelines, and a vacabulary list. Included is a CD that contains audio material for some of the exercises and an enrichment program linked to the text.
Hebrew University of Jerusalem - The Hebrew University of Jerusalem (האוניברסיטה העברית בירושלים) is one of Israel's oldest, largest and most important institutes of higher learning and research. The Hebrew University is one of the eight universities in Israel. Hebrew University High School - The Hebrew University High School, commonly known as Leyada, is a six-year, secular, "experimental", academically-autonomous, semi-private secondary school. It is located next to the Hebrew University Givat-Ram campus in Jerusalem. Baltimore Hebrew University - Baltimore Hebrew University was founded as Baltimore Hebrew College and Teachers Training School in 1919 to promote Jewish scholarship and academic excellence, it continues to be the only institution of higher learning in Maryland devoted solely to all aspects of Judaic and Hebraic studies. Located in the northwest, Park Heights neighborhood, section of Baltimore, BHU confers degrees up to the doctorate level. Brigham Young University Jerusalem Center - The Brigham Young University Jerusalem Center for Near-Eastern Studies is a study center for Brigham Young University situated on Mount Scopus in East Jerusalem. The center teaches curriculum concerning the Middle East, and Hebrew and Arabic language courses.
